/*! Themestr.app `Darkster` Bootstrap 4.3.1 theme */

@use 'sass:map';


///==========================================
///   Theme variable overrides
///==========================================

@import "./abstract";

// Fonts
@import url(https://fonts.googleapis.com/css?family=Comfortaa:200,300,400,700);
$headings-font-family: "Comfortaa";

// Colors
$primary    :#FF550B;
$secondary  :#303030;
$success    :#015668;
$danger     :#FF304F;
$info       :#0F81C7;
$warning    :#0DE2EA;
$light      :#e8e8e8;
$dark       :#000000;

$theme-colors: map.merge(
  $theme-colors,
  (
    'primary': $primary,
    'secondary': $secondary,
    'success': $success,
    'danger': $danger,
    'info': $info,
    'warning': $warning,
    'light': $light,
    'dark': $dark,
  )
);

$gray-50 : #121212; // (+)
$gray-100: #212529;
$gray-150: #2E2E2E; // (+)
$gray-175: #333333; // (+)
$gray-200: #343A40;
$gray-300: #495057;
$gray-400: #6C757D;
$gray-500: #ADB5BD;
$gray-600: #CED4DA;
$gray-700: #DEE2E6;
$gray-800: #E9ECEF;
$gray-900: #F8F9FA;

$annotation-text-color: $gray-600;
$annotation-field-base-alpha: 15%;


// (overriding bootstrap "_variable.scss")
$enable-shadows:true;
$body-bg:$black;
$body-color:#cccccc;
$link-color:#f0f0f0;
$font-size-base:1.1rem;
$list-group-bg:lighten($body-bg,5%);
$card-border-color:rgba($black, 0.6);
$card-cap-bg:lighten($gray-800, 10%);
$card-bg:lighten($body-bg, 5%);
$input-bg:$gray-300;
$input-disabled-bg: $gray-100;

// Misc...
// $enable-shadows:true;
// $body-bg:$black;
// $body-color:#cccccc;
// $link-color:#f0f0f0;
// $link-hover-color:darken($link-color,20%);
// $font-size-base:1.1rem;
// $table-accent-bg: rgba($white,.05);
// $table-hover-bg:rgba($white,.075);
// $table-border-color:rgba($white, 0.3);
// $table-dark-border-color: $table-border-color;
// $table-dark-color:$white;
// $input-bg:$gray-300;
// $input-disabled-bg: #ccc;
// $dropdown-bg:$gray-800;
// $dropdown-divider-bg:rgba($black,.15);
// $dropdown-link-color:$body-color;
// $dropdown-link-hover-color:$white;
// $dropdown-link-hover-bg:$body-bg;
// $nav-tabs-border-color:rgba($white, 0.3);
// $nav-tabs-link-hover-border-color:$nav-tabs-border-color;
// $nav-tabs-link-active-bg:transparent;
// $nav-tabs-link-active-border-color:$nav-tabs-border-color;
// $navbar-dark-hover-color:$white;
// $navbar-light-hover-color:$gray-800;
// $navbar-light-active-color:$gray-800;
// $pagination-color:$white;
// $pagination-bg:transparent;
// $pagination-border-color:rgba($black, 0.6);
// $pagination-hover-color:$white;
// $pagination-hover-bg:transparent;
// $pagination-hover-border-color:rgba($black, 0.6);
// $pagination-active-bg:transparent;
// $pagination-active-border-color:rgba($black, 0.6);
// $pagination-disabled-bg:transparent;
// $pagination-disabled-border-color:rgba($black, 0.6);
// $jumbotron-bg:darken($gray-900, 5%);
// $card-border-color:rgba($black, 0.6);
// $card-cap-bg:lighten($gray-800, 10%);
// $card-bg:lighten($body-bg, 5%);
// $modal-content-bg:lighten($body-bg,5%);
// $modal-header-border-color:rgba(0,0,0,.2);
// $progress-bg:darken($gray-900,5%);
// $progress-bar-color:$gray-600;
// $list-group-bg:lighten($body-bg,5%);
// $list-group-border-color:rgba($black,0.6);
// $list-group-hover-bg:lighten($body-bg,10%);
// $list-group-active-color:$white;
// $list-group-active-bg:$list-group-hover-bg;
// $list-group-active-border-color:$list-group-border-color;
// $list-group-disabled-color:$gray-800;
// $list-group-disabled-bg:$black;
// $list-group-action-color:$white;
// $breadcrumb-active-color:$gray-500;


///==========================================
///   Custom styles specific to the theme
///==========================================

@import './_base';


.navbar-dark.bg-primary {background-color:#111111 !important;}
.table.able {color:#ccccc5}
#sp-container .table tr td a { color: #005a9aff; }

.nav-tabs .nav-link.active, .nav-tabs .nav-item.show .nav-link {
  background-color: $gray-300;
  color: $gray-700
}
.nav.nav-tabs li a.nav-link.active:hover {
  color: $gray-900;
}
.form-control,
.form-control:focus{
  background-color: $gray-300;
  color: $gray-700;
}
.card-header {
  background-color: $gray-400;
}